Output 666d35413cc5bf330454ec8c2d7fa40c0e662a73cee16ee488a1c7682a9379c6:0

value
109270
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cb39e5d1f70c97e3bae8064ab9ba016432925b9 OP_EQUAL
address
MHovPGUPYC3uDQnoqHQxGipvXny4yDH2h3
transaction
666d35413cc5bf330454ec8c2d7fa40c0e662a73cee16ee488a1c7682a9379c6
spent
true